How to Find a Reliable Workers Compensation Lawyer

Mar 26, 2024

Injuries can happen at any time, even on a job. At least if you have a proven workplace injury, you're eligible for workers compensation. However, getting your due claim may be easier said than done. Luckily, you can get legal assistance to help you. Here are tips for finding a reliable workers compensation lawyer.


Contact Someone You Know Who Made a Claim


Do you know anyone else who had to make a workers compensation claim? If so, see who they used as a lawyer and if they can give you a referral. A referral can be a way to narrow down your options. If you have a good relationship with this person, they may feel comfortable giving you information about the type of payout their lawyer was able to get them and how long it took.


Ask About Your Lawyer's Track Record


According to the National Council on Compensation Insurance, American workers compensation net written premiums increased 11% during the past year, rising to $47.5 billion. What exactly is your prospective lawyer's track record with giving a client a piece of that compensation from employer premiums? After all, you don't want to waste your time with a workers compensation lawyer without a good track record of helping injured workers. Plus, a professional and experienced attorney will be honest about the validity of your case and how much they can get you.


Get References


If you don't know anyone to give you personal references, you could always ask your lawyer for some during a consultation. When they have enough satisfied clients, they shouldn't have a problem giving you some references to contact. That way, you can have assurance you're working with a qualified legal professional who can help you.


Check Reviews


In addition to direct references, you can check online reviews. After all, people leave reviews for any service, including legal help. From Google reviews to Reddit to Trustpilot, you should look up your legal firm and see what other clients have said about their services.
